Masaru Company Description
Masaru Corporation engages in the construction activities in Japan.
It is involved in the building repair and renovation works; condominium and building renewal works; and skyscraper sealing and waterproofing works.
The company also involves in construction of facilities, such as air conditioning, heating and cooling, and water supply and drainage, as well as assembles, installs, and maintains industrial machinery, such as exhaust equipment, drying and painting equipment, and dust collection equipment.
In addition, it sells building materials and engages in rental of equipment. Masaru Corporation was incorporated in 1957 and is headquartered in Koto, Japan.
